One of the axe skills has the possibility to stun and bleed your opponent. Something a lock can't without the DoT's (atleast the bleed part). That's why I would look into getting that skill atleast.
Re: Question About 2handed/Warlock
Posted: Sat Dec 18, 2010 4:32 pm
by lotri
XMoshe wrote:One of the axe skills has the possibility to stun and bleed your opponent. Something a lock can't without the DoT's (atleast the bleed part). That's why I would look into getting that skill atleast.
Yeah... plus Sudden Twist has a chance to do both with 1 attack while dealing damage. With warlock, you'll need to cast the DoT and then cast Daze (2 skills that won't deal as much damage).
